Did you know that the food we eat says a lot about how we love? Psychologist Dr Andrea Oskis shows us how we connect with each other and how we can change our personal ‘recipes’ to have better relationships.
Along the way, she also reveals her own food story about love and loss. Inviting us into her therapy room with her patients, she tells us: the real reason why comfort food comforts, why dessert isn’t a good idea when you’re stressed, and why you should never give a bottle of hot sauce to someone who has been rejected.
Be prepared to never look at your plate in the same way again.
